Looking at reporting and discussion of the 2020 presidential campaign, has any word been misused as often as “misinformation”? In much political debate, it was used to mean “information I don’t like,” rather than something that was provably false. That confusion extends to a new survey of American attitudes done by Gallup and the John S. and James L. Knight Foundation. The survey questioned 2,752 …
